body, table, input, textarea, select {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#666;
	line-height:14px;
}
body {
	margin: 0px;
	padding: 0px;
	background-color: #ededed;
	behavior: url('/style/csshover.htc');
}


h1 { color: #B10202; font-size:15px;padding:0 0 5px 0; margin:0px;}
h2 { color: #474746; font-size:15px;padding:0 0 5px 0;;margin:0px;}
h3 { color: #B10202; font-size:12px;padding:0px;margin:0px;}
h4 { color: #474746; }
.searchcontrol a{
	color:#00f;
	text-decoration: underline; 
}
.searchcontrol a.hover{
	color:#00f;
	text-decoration: none; 
}
div.search_button{
	padding-top:5px;
	text-align:center;
	width:150px;
}
select.search_select{
	width:154px;
}

input, textarea, select { color: #666; padding-right:3px; margin-bottom:2px;}
input.google { border:solid 0px;margin:0px;padding:0px;}

select { padding:1px; margin-top:5px; margin-bottom:2px;}
form { display:inline; }
a { 
	font:normal 11px Tahoma;
	text-decoration: underline;
}
a:hover { text-decoration: none; }


* html p {margin:10px auto 10px auto;}
.nav { 
	width:770; 
	height:239px;
	background-color:#ededed;
	background-image: url(/_assets/_header_css/hrt_04_1/_images/static_hrt.jpg);
	background-repeat: no-repeat;

}
.nav table a { color:#FFFFFF; }
.nav table a:hover { color:#FF9900; } 
#myMenuID 
{
	position:absolute;
	padding-left:10px;
	top:202px;
	width:700px; 
	height:35px;
	z-index:1001;
	background-color:transparent;
}
.MenuRight 
{
	line-height:24px;
	text-align:right;
	position:absolute;
	padding-right:10px;
	padding-top:0px;
	right:0px;
	top:206px;
	width:300px; 
	z-index:1010;
	background-color:transparent;
	color:#B8B7B7;
	font:normal 24px Tahoma;
	border:0px solid #f00;
}
.MenuRight a { 
	font:normal 24px Tahoma;
	line-height:24px;
	text-decoration: none;
}
a:hover { text-decoration: none; }


.HeadName{
	position:absolute;
	left:0px;
	top:120px;
	width:100%;
	height:40px;
	text-align:center;
}
/* styles that define the main table structure */
.tdContent {
	width:770px;
	font-size: 10px;
	color: #666;
    background-color: #FFF;
    vertical-align: top;
}

/*
.tdContent a { color: #888; }
.tdContent a:hover { color: #888; }
*/

/* footer styles */
.footerLinkspress { font-size: 9px; padding:10px; text-align:center; clear: both; }
.footerLinks, .footerCredit { font-size: 10px; width:590px; padding:7px; text-align:right; clear: both; }
.footerLinks { color: #666666; }

/* column boxes */
.boxNav {
	color: #777;
	padding: 10px;
	margin: 0px;
	font-size: 11px;
	line-height: 135%;
}
.boxNav a { color: #888; }
.boxNav a:hover { text-decoration: underline; }
.boxNav ul { margin:0 0 0 10px;line-height:130%;list-style-image: url(/_assets/_images/bullets_arrow.gif); }
.boxNav li { padding-left: -5px; }
.boxNav blockquote { margin: 0 0 0 8px; }
.boxTitle{
	font-size: 11px;
	font-weight: bold;
	color: #474746;
	background-color: #59757B;
	padding: 2px 2px 2px 6px;
	margin: 0px 0 0 0px;
	border-top: 0px solid #C7C7C7;
	border-right: 1px solid #C7C7C7;
	border-bottom: 1px solid #fff;
	border-left: 1px solid #C7C7C7;
}
.boxBody, .boxBodyWhite {	
	border-right: 1px solid #C7C7C7;
	border-bottom: 1px solid #C7C7C7;
	border-top: 1px solid #C7C7C7;
	border-left: 1px solid #C7C7C7;
	padding: 5px 10px 0 10px;
	margin: 0px;
	color: #59757B;
	font:normal 11px Tahoma;
	color: #666666;
	line-height:14px;
}
.boxBodyWhite {
	border-bottom: 0px solid #C7C7C7;
	height:180px;
}
.boxBody_block {	
	padding-top:5px;
	padding-bottom:5px;
}
.boxTitleGoogle{
	font-size: 11px;
	font-weight: bold;
	color: #474746;
	background-color: #59757B;
	padding: 2px 2px 3px 6px;
	margin: 5px 0 0 0px;
	border-top: 0px solid #C7C7C7;
	border-right: 1px solid #C7C7C7;
	border-bottom: 1px solid #fff;
	border-left: 1px solid #C7C7C7;
}

.boxBodyGoogle {	
	border-right: 1px solid #C7C7C7;
	border-bottom: 1px solid #C7C7C7;
	border-top: 1px solid #C7C7C7;
	border-left: 1px solid #C7C7C7;
	padding: 10px 10px 0 10px;
	margin: 0px;
	color: #59757B;
	font:normal 11px Tahoma;
	color: #666666;
	line-height:14px;
}
/* .boxBody h3{ color: #59757B; font-size: 11px; margin: 0 0 5px 0px; } */
.boxBody img{
	margin: 0 5px 5px 0px;
	border: 1px solid #ccc;
	/* float: left; */
}

.playBody img{
	margin: 0 0px 0px 0px;
	border: 1px solid #ccc;
	/* float: left; */
}

div.img_news{
	
	width: 100%;
	margin:0px;
	 
	text-align: center;
}
div.img_news img{
	margin:0px;
	padding:0px;
	width: 328px;
	height:235px;
}
div.img_news a:link, div.img_news a:visited, div.img_news a:active, div.img_news a:hover{
	float:none;
	margin:0px;
	padding:0px;
	text-decoration:none;
}

.boxBody:after , .boxBodyWhite:after{
    content: "."; 
    display: block; 
    height: 0px;
    clear: both; 
    visibility: hidden;
}
.boxBody h3, .popBody h3 {
}

.playBody{
	font:normal 11px Tahoma;
	line-height:14px;
	color:#666666;
	padding-bottom:5px;
}
.playBody td{
	font:normal 11px Tahoma;
	line-height:14px;
	color:#666666;
}
.playBody h3, .searchm h3{
	padding:4px 4px 4px 0;
	font:bold 12px Tahoma;
	color:#B10202;
}
.playBody a:link, .playBody a:visited, .playBody a:active,
.boxBody a.more:link, .boxBody a.more:visited, .boxBody a.more:active,
/*a.more:link, a.more:visited, a.more:active {*/
a.more:link, a.more:visited, a.more:active {
	padding-top:5px;
	float:right;
	font-weight:bold;
	font-size:10px;
	text-decoration:none;
}
a.more:hover{
	text-decoration:underline;
}
/* Oldalsavok linkelt cimei */
a.boxBody_Title:link, a.boxBody_Title:visited, a.boxBody_Title:active {
	/* color:#656463; */
	padding-bottom:6px;
	font-weight:bold;
	font-size:11px;
	line-height:15px;
}
a.boxBody_Title:hover{
	/* color:#656463; */
}

/* Center sáv linkelt cimei */
a.boxBody_Title_center:link, a.boxBody_Title_center:visited, a.boxBody_Title_center:active {
    float: none; 
	color:#B10202;
	margin-bottom:6px;
	font-weight:bold;
	font-size:12px;
	line-height:18px;
}
a.boxBody_Title_center:hover{
	color:#B10202;
}


.playBody a:link, .playBody a:visited, .playBody a:active
{
	color: #B10202;
	padding-bottom:5px;
}
.playBody a.center_title:link, .playBody a.center_title:visited, .playBody a.center_title:active
{
    float: left; 
	color: #B10202;
	text-decoration:underline;
}
.playBody a.center_title:hover{
	color: #B10202;
	text-decoration:none;
}

.playBody a:hover,
.boxBody a.more:hover,
.playBody a:hover{
	color: #B10202;
	text-decoration:underline;
}
.list_box{
	line-height:18px;
}
.navi{	
	border-right: 1px solid #C7C7C7;
	border-bottom: 1px solid #C7C7C7;
	border-left: 1px solid #C7C7C7;
	padding: 0px 0px 5px 0px;
	color: #59757B;
	/*font:bold 10px;*/
	display:block;
	text-align:right;
}

*html .clearfix{height: 1%;}

.clearfix:after {
    content: "."; 
    display: block; 
    height: 0px; 
    clear: both; 
    visibility: hidden;
}
.box{
	position:relative;
	width:200px;
	height:150px;
	border:1px solid #ab5555;
}
.cnt_label{
	background:url(pic/base/bg_label.jpg) repeat-x;
	height:30px;
}
table.tbl_box_center_head td, table.tbl_box_center_FCK td, table.tbl_box_center td, table.tbl_box td, table.dname td,
td.search_left, td.search_right{
	font:normal 11px Tahoma;
	padding-top:5px;
}
table.tbl_box_center_head{
	cursor:pointer;
}
div.dname{
	font:normal 11px Tahoma;
	margin:3px 4px 3px 4px;
	width:186px;
	border:0px solid #f00;
}
table.tbl_box_center h3, table.tbl_box_center_head h3, table.tbl_box_center_FCK h3{
	font:bold 12px Tahoma;
	margin:0px;
	padding:1px;
	color:#B10202;
}
table.tbl_box_center h5, table.tbl_box_center_head h5, table.tbl_box_center_FCK h5{
	font:italic 11px Tahoma;
	margin:0px;
	padding:0 0 5px 0;
}
.tbl_box_center img, .tbl_box_center_head img{
	float:left;
	margin-right:5px;
	margin-bottom:5px;
}
.tbl_box_center_FCK img{
}

.tbl_box_center_FCK p{
	/* margin: 0px; */
	/* padding: 0px; */
	text-align: justify;
}

td.cnt_left{
	border:0px solid #f00;
	padding:0 1px 0 6px;
	width:201px;
}
td.cnt_center{
	border:0px solid #f00;
	padding:0px 6px 0 6px;
	width:368px;
}
td.cnt_center h2{
	font:bold 15px Tahoma;
	color:#B10202;
}
td.cnt_center h1{
	font:bold 15px Tahoma;
	color:#B10202;
}
td.cnt_right{
	border:0px solid #f00;
	padding:0 6px 0 1px;
	width:201px;
}
table.tbl_box_Head{
	padding:0 4px 15px 4px;
	width:194px;
}
table.tbl_box{
	padding:0 14px 5px 14px;
	width:194px;
}
table.box_around{
	padding:0 0px 5px 0px;
}
table.tbl_box_center, table.tbl_box_center_head, table.tbl_box_center_FCK{
	padding:0 6px 0 6px;
	width:356px;
}
td.search_left{
	width:50%;
	border-right:1px solid #999;
	padding-right:8px;
}
td.search_right{
	width:50%;
	padding-left:8px;
}

/* Small controls */
.bpause, .bpause_off{
	width:22px;
	background-repeat: no-repeat;
	background-position: center top;
	cursor:hand;
	padding-right:2px;
	padding-left:2px;
}
.bpause{
	background-image:url(pic/box/pctrl.jpg);
}
.bpause_off{
	background-image:url(pic/box/pctrl_off.jpg);
}
.back{
	background-image:url(pic/box/bctrl.jpg);
	background-repeat: no-repeat;
	background-position: right top;
	cursor:hand;
	padding-left:10px;
}
.forw{
	background-image:url(pic/box/fctrl.jpg) ;
	background-repeat: no-repeat;
	background-position: left top;
	cursor:hand;
	padding-right:0px;
}
/* Big controls */
.bbpause, .bbpause_off{
	width:30px;
	background-repeat: no-repeat;
	background-position: center top;
	cursor:hand;
	padding-right:2px;
	padding-left:2px;
}
.bbpause{
	background-image:url(pic/box/bpctrl.jpg);
}
.bbpause_off{
	background-image:url(pic/box/bpctrl_off.jpg);
}
.bback{
	background-image:url(pic/box/bbctrl.jpg);
	background-repeat: no-repeat;
	background-position: right top;
	cursor:hand;
	padding-left:10px;
}
.bforw{
	background-image:url(pic/box/bfctrl.jpg) ;
	background-repeat: no-repeat;
	background-position: left top;
	cursor:hand;
	padding-right:0px;
}
.playert{
	background:url(pic/base/player_top.jpg) no-repeat;
	height:5px;
}
.playerm{
	background:url(pic/base/player_mid.jpg) repeat-y;
	padding:7px 15px 7px 15px;
}
.playerb{
	background:url(pic/base/player_bottom.jpg) no-repeat;
	height:5px;
}
.bplayert{
	background:url(pic/base/bplayer_top.jpg) no-repeat;
	height:5px;
}
.bplayerm{
	background:url(pic/base/bplayer_mid.jpg) repeat-y;
	padding:7px 10px 7px 10px;
}
.bplayerm_text{
	padding:0 5px 0 5px;
}
.bplayerb{
	background:url(pic/base/bplayer_bottom.jpg) no-repeat;
	height:5px;
}
.searcht{
	background:url(pic/base/bplayer_top.jpg) no-repeat;
	height:5px;
}
.searchm{
	background:url(pic/base/search_mid.jpg) repeat-y;
	padding:7px 15px 7px 15px;
}
.searchb{
	background:url(pic/base/bplayer_bottom.jpg) no-repeat;
	height:5px;
}
div.search_line{
	background:url(pic/base/search_line_mid2.jpg) no-repeat;
	width:326px;
	height:17px;
	margin-top:2px;
	margin-bottom:2px;
}
/* Search  */
div.list{
	padding-bottom:5px;
}
div.list_data{
	padding-left:19px;
	line-height:18px;
}
div.list a:link, div.list a:visited, div.list a:active{
	font:bold 11px;
	color:#EC7A04;
	text-decoration:underline;
}
div.list a:hover{
	color:#EC7A04;
	text-decoration:none;
}
/* Extra képek forgóba */
div.img_aktiv, div.img_feltoltodes, div.img_kalandor, div.img_puszta, div.img_vizpart, div.img_hegyvidek{
	margin-top:2px;
	padding-left:54px;
	padding-top:0px;
	height:48px;
}
div.img_aktiv{
	background:url(pic/other/raktiv.jpg) no-repeat;
}
div.img_feltoltodes{
	background:url(pic/other/rfeltoltodes.jpg) no-repeat;
}
div.img_kalandor{
	background:url(pic/other/rkalandor.jpg) no-repeat;
}
div.img_puszta{
	background:url(pic/other/rpuszta.jpg) no-repeat;
}
div.img_vizpart{
	background:url(pic/other/rvizpart.jpg) no-repeat;
}
div.img_hegyvidek{
	background:url(pic/other/rhegyvidek.jpg) no-repeat;
}


/* Ikonok */
div.img_cim, div.img_email, div.img_izelito, div.img_jellemzok, div.img_terkep{
	padding-left:35px;
	padding-top:12px;
}
div.img_rcim, div.img_remail, div.img_rizelito, div.img_rjellemzok, div.img_rterkep{
	padding-left:19px;
	padding-top:3px;
}
div.rtemp_min, div.rtemp_max{
	padding-left:19px;
	padding-top:2px;
	margin-top:2px;
 }

div.img_cim{
	background:url(pic/icon/cim.gif) no-repeat;
}
div.img_email{
	background:url(pic/icon/email.gif) no-repeat;
}
div.img_izelito{
	background:url(pic/icon/izelito.gif) no-repeat;
}
div.img_jellemzok{
	background:url(pic/icon/jellemzok.gif) no-repeat;
}
div.img_terkep{
	background:url(pic/icon/terkep.gif) no-repeat;
}
/* Mini */
div.img_rcim{
	background:url(pic/icon/rcim.gif) no-repeat;
}
div.img_remail{
	background:url(pic/icon/remail.gif) no-repeat;
}
div.img_rizelito{
	background:url(pic/icon/rizelito.gif) no-repeat;
}
div.img_rjellemzok{
	background:url(pic/icon/rjellemzok.gif) no-repeat;
}
div.img_rterkep{
	background:url(pic/icon/rterkep.gif) no-repeat;
}
div.rtemp_min{
	background:url(pic/icon/temp_min_18.jpg) no-repeat;
}
div.rtemp_max{
	background:url(pic/icon/temp_max_18.jpg) no-repeat;
}

/* Calendar */

a.footer:link, a.footer:visited, a.footer:active { color: #888; }
a.footer:hover { color: #888; }
